We are seeking an exceptional Spa Receptionist to join our Spa at Claridge’s.

Set in the heart of Mayfair, Claridge’s is an art deco icon and a byword for understated elegance. Since the 1850s, Claridge’s has excelled at the finer things in life: glamorous design, inspiring dining, impeccable service. There are many 5-star hotels in London but nowhere quite like Claridge’s. The hotel is a unique combination of splendour and charm with long-standing connections with royalty that have led to it sometimes being referred to as “annexe to Buckingham Palace”. Claridge’s has a famous all-day dining and Afternoon Tea restaurant the ‘Foyer & Reading Room’, L’Epicerie that offers a culinary theatre of the kitchen, the newly opened Claridge’s Restaurant and three bars: Claridge’s Bar, the intimate Fumoir and effortlessly elegant Painter’s Room.

Responsibilities
  • Making reservations and develop excellent product and treatment knowledge, in order to advise guests of the products and treatments that would suit their needs.
  • Opening up the Health Club and Spa in the morning, meeting and greeting guests and visitors throughout the day. Processing payments, controlling any reception based administration/filing, processing vouchers and membership and mail order product sales are also part of this position.
  • Ensuring that all facilities are kept immaculate e.g. fruits, water, juices and towel supplies for the guests are restocked.
